Face-lifted 2025 BYD Atto 3 Revealed Through Ministry Filings

The 2025 BYD Atto 3 has leaked thanks to documents filed with the Chinese Ministry of Industry and Information Technology (MIIT). Revealed through which are the EV crossover’s subtle but sharpened design tweaks, and more.

One of the most noticeable changes is the redesigned front bumper, which now boasts a more aggressive and dynamic design. Both the grille and headlights remain unchanged,whereas the rear bumper has been revised to align with the front's. New here too is roof spoiler featuring dual vertical brake lights a la the GAC GS3 Emzoom.

Other exterior updates include redesigned roof pillars and decorative silver stripes along the lower edges of the car, which add a premium touch to its overall aesthetics. There are no interior images revealed from this leak, thus indicating that perhaps this update will most likely be confined to the exterior only.

Another key and visible change is the presence of a front bumper-mounted camera. This likely  suggests that the 2025MY Atto 3 might gain an uprated advanced driver assistance system (ADAS) features thanks to BYD’s recent partnership with DJI in exploring this cutting-edge tech.

In Malaysia, the Atto 3 underwent several specification changes since it first launched in Dec 2022. Initially, two variants were offered - Standard Range packing a 49.9-kWh battery pack with a 410 KM range and an Extended Range guise primed with a 60.4-kWh battery boasting a 480 KM range figure instead.

In May 2024, the Extended Range was dropped, leaving the Standard Range on sale, but this would change again in  Sept 2024 when the Extended Range was reintroduced with the new "Enhanced" trim priced at RM149,800.

Although no launch date has been announced yet, credible online sources in China reportedly that BYD will start rolling out this renewed version of its Atto 3 rollout in the second quarter (Q2) of 2025, as the MIIT filing also typically signals the start of trial production.

Once this happens, we are sure it won’t be long before Malaysia’s most popular EV SUV sees yet another update.
